The Yen's Safe Haven Status
The Japanese Yen, a currency with global influence, has a unique relationship with market sentiment. Its value is not solely determined by economic performance but also by the BoJ's policy decisions and risk appetite among traders. Interestingly, the BoJ's ultra-loose monetary policy over the years has influenced the Yen's value, causing depreciation against major currencies. This policy divergence with other central banks, especially the US Federal Reserve, has played a significant role in the Yen's fluctuations.
What many fail to grasp is the psychological aspect of the Yen's safe-haven status. During market turmoil, investors flock to the Yen, perceiving it as a stable haven. This phenomenon can lead to a self-fulfilling prophecy, strengthening the Yen's position in the global currency hierarchy. However, with the BoJ's recent policy adjustments, we might witness a shift in this dynamic.
